    I would strongly caution anyone considering using Imperial Restoration for water remediation…read moreservices, specifically my experience dealing with Scott Gamble. After discovering a leak in my kitchen that caused plywood damage and warping, I asked my plumber for a recommendation for water cleanup/remediation. I was referred to Imperial Restoration, and from the beginning Scott Gamble was extremely persistent and pressured me into acting immediately. He repeatedly emphasized the urgency, warned me about mold, placed a blower in the home, and strongly pushed me to open an insurance claim, assuring me the damage should be covered. Because of his persistence, I contacted my insurance company and asked whether they could begin mitigation work while the claim was being reviewed. Based on the information and photos Scott already submitted to insurance, I was told they could proceed. Work started on May 6 and was finished by May 8. Here are my concerns: * No written estimate was provided before work began. * I did not receive clear pricing upfront before authorizing work. * I felt pressured into making quick decisions out of fear of mold and further damage. * Scott repeatedly pushed me to pressure my insurance adjuster for approvals and communication. * The company left my kitchen in disarray, including tarps and debris. * I specifically asked whether they would also restore/replace the damaged cabinets and kitchen components, and was told they had "a contractor" for that instead of handling it directly. Ultimately, my homeowners insurance denied the claim, stating the damage appeared to be long-term and not a sudden covered loss. Now I am personally stuck with an invoice for $3,377.91 due June 1, 2026, for work that I felt rushed and pressured into approving under the belief it would likely be covered by insurance. I was also later informed that concerns had arisen regarding some of the documentation/photos that had been submitted to insurance, which made me even more uncomfortable with the entire situation. Now my elderly father is left without a functioning kitchen sink, garbage disposal, or dishwasher, and this entire experience has created tremendous stress for our family. My advice to anyone dealing with water damage: Please get multiple opinions and multiple estimates before authorizing work. Do not let fear tactics or pressure rush you into making decisions. Ask for everything in writing before any work starts, including estimates, scope of work, billing expectations, and insurance responsibilities. I regret not slowing down and getting second and third opinions first.
